| Project | What to order | Depth or note |
|---|---|---|
| Raised beds and gardens | Topsoil | 6 to 8 inches deep for most vegetables |
| New lawn | Topsoil | 4 to 6 inches over existing ground |
| Regrading after construction | Topsoil | Spread to match surrounding grade |
| Over-seeding topdress | Topsoil | About a quarter- to half-inch layer |
| Leveling low spots in a yard | Topsoil | Fill low areas, then compact lightly |

Estimating the right amount starts with the area you plan to cover and the target depth. A ton of topsoil covers roughly 100 square feet at 3 inches deep, but coverage varies with compaction and moisture. No. Bainbridge sees about 30 freezing days a year, but the ground does not freeze deep enough to affect how topsoil performs. Standard topsoil works well here. The frost line is shallow, so the surface does not heave enough to disturb a new lawn or garden bed.
The main factor is the 53 inches of annual rainfall. Topsoil that drains well will last many years, but heavy rain can wash away a loose layer if there is no ground cover. Installing sod or seed quickly, and adding mulch on beds, protects the topsoil from erosion.
